Abstract
The title compounds, tetrabenzyl-2 kappa C,3 kappa C,4kC,5 kappa C-oct a-mu 3 -chloro-bis(tributylphosphine)-1 kappa P,6 kappa P-octa-hedro - hexamolybdenum(12Mo-Mo), (1), and tetrakis(phenylethynyl)-2 kappa C,3 kappa C,4 kappa C,5 kappa C -octa-mu 3-chloro-bis(tripentylphosphine)- 1 kappa P,6 kappa P-octahedro-hexamolybdenum (12Mo-Mo)-toluene (1/2), (2), containing octahedral Mo clusters with four sigma-C ligands, wer e prepared by the reaction of trans-[(Mo6Cl8)Cl-4(PR3)(2)] with triben zylaluminium and tris(phenylethynyl)aluminium, respectively, and their structures determined. The octahedral Mo-6 cores of both compounds ar e on inversion centres and are almost regular. Average interatomic dis tances in the clusters for (1) are Mo-Mo-edge 2.618, Mo...Mo-opposite 3.703, Mo-Cl 2.477 and Mo-C 2.26 Angstrom, and for (2) are Mo-Mo-edge 2.626, Mo...Mo-opposite 3.714 and Mo-C 2.13 Angstrom.
